Significance

New bicyclo[6.1.0]nonyne (BCN) ring-strained alkynes (e.g. endo- 2) are readily ­accessible, stable, and exhibit excellent kinetics in metal-free alkyne-azide and alkyne-nitrone ­cycloadditions (3, 4). The C s symmetry of BCN simplifies NMR analysis and produces a single ­regioisomer upon cycloaddition.
